EMPTY + MEADOWS + THE UNDERTAKING @ THE SENTIENT BEAN

South Carolina’s Empty (pictured) fits hip hop and metalcore into their indie rock, and they tend to get all over the place in their live shows, physically and sonically. Alabammy’s Meadows play a modern melodic hardcore. San Diego’s The Undertaking get right to the point with chaotic energy in compelling, brutal blasts. Quite a lineup, Tim.

XIU XIU + DREAMEND @ THE LODGE OF SORROWS

The San Jose experimental rock outfit formed more than 20 years ago. Leader Jamie Stewart cites as influences Nina Simone, The Birthday Party and Orchestral Maneuvers in the Dark, however that works. The live material is different than the recorded, with emphasis on “the loud rock parts” but the experience is unique. Ryan Graveface’s Dreamend open up.

HOVVDY @ DISTRICT LIVE

The Austin indie rockers are known for supremely soulful vocals and a distinctly mellow Americana vibe at times labeled slowcore. Very amusing, but it fits. Seems anyone in the Wilco, Jaybirds, folk and Dead vibe would be converted fast. Whitmer Thomas and girlpuppy, aka Becca Harvey, support.

MOONCHILD @ VICTORY NORTH

The LA alt-R&B/neo-soul trio got a jumpstart with praise any band would kill for: the endorsement of Stevie Wonder. He was impressed enough to invite them to open for his annual benefit concert. That should be enough information to pack the hall, but they back up the legend’s trust with their own modern take on the genre, at times reminiscent of the great Erykah Badu.

GABBY WATTS @ THE WORMHOLE

The stand-up comic and punk rock musician who does not like comedy music hit the TikTok jackpot with — you guessed it — comedy music. She wisely embraced it, branding It “anxiety pop,” and worked it into her routine. It’s not necessarily a music show, but she does host a monthly gig in her native Atlanta named Comedy Bandstand where the jokes must be sung with a backing band.

BASIK LEE + QUINCE @ EL ROCKO LOUNGE

The Illtown native and musical chameleon has been playing a multitude of music styles to Savannah audiences for years. A former member of local hip-hop collective Dope Sandwich, Lee embraces the bigger picture of spreading sound and can be found strapped with a guitar as often as he’s dominating a microphone.

THE BUZZARDS OF FUZZ + SPACE COKE @ EL ROCKO

The dons of Atlanta stoner rock fly through Savannah again, dropping untold ounces of heavy desert sounds. Distortion sectarians are encouraged to worship. Given the date, it’d be a sin to miss Space Coke’s closing 45-minute rendition of Sweet Leaf. The Pinx and Pink Peugeot light it up and pass it around early.

MANDI STRACHOTA @ FOXY LOXY CAFE

Treat yourself to a rich blend of R&B, gospel, and soul, with a shot of grit and a splash of country sway. Mandi Strachota covers a lot of ground and you’d be pressed not to notice how her voice percolates above it all. She’s also a lot better than these weak-as-Keurig coffee puns.
